New cell therapy aims to fight cancer and heal kidneys in myeloma patients
NCT ID NCT07489534
Summary
This study is testing a new type of CAR-T cell therapy for people with multiple myeloma who also have kidney problems. The therapy uses the patient's own modified immune cells to target the cancer. Researchers want to see if this treatment can help control the myeloma and improve kidney function after initial chemotherapy.
